只为小站
首页
域名查询
文件下载
登录
mac hadoop报错
native
需要的包
在Mac系统上使用Hadoop时,可能会遇到一个常见的问题,即“Unable to load
native
-hadoop library”。这个错误信息表明Hadoop在尝试加载本地库(
native
library)时失败,通常是由于缺少必要的依赖或配置不当导致的。针对这个问题,我们需要深入了解Hadoop的运行机制以及如何在MacOS环境下解决这个问题。 Hadoop是一个分布式计算框架,它使用Java编写,但为了提高性能,它依赖于一些本地库(如libhadoop.so),这些库提供了与操作系统进行底层交互的功能,如文件系统操作和内存管理。在MacOS上,Hadoop默认可能无法找到这些本地库,因此会抛出错误。 为了解决这个问题,首先需要确保你的Hadoop版本与你的系统兼容。例如,你提到的是Hadoop3.2.4,这是一个较新的版本,应该支持MacOS。如果遇到问题,可能是由于未正确安装或配置Hadoop导致的。 1. **安装OpenJDK**:Hadoop需要Java环境来运行,尽管MacOS通常预装了Java,但有时可能不是最新版本或者不被Hadoop识别。建议安装OpenJDK 8或更高版本,并将其设置为默认Java版本。 2. **构建本地库**:Hadoop的源代码包含编译本地库的选项。你可以从Apache Hadoop的官方网站下载源码,然后使用`./configure --with-
native
-libraries`命令来编译并生成适用于MacOS的本地库。这一步可能需要安装Xcode和相关开发者工具。 3. **配置环境变量**:在`~/.bashrc`或`~/.zshrc`(取决于你的Shell类型)文件中添加以下行来指定Hadoop的本地库路径: ``` export HADOOP_OPTS="-Djava.library.path=/path/to/your/
native
/libs" ``` 替换`/path/to/your/
native
/libs`为你的本地库实际路径。 4. **检查安全工具(SIP)**:MacOS的System Integrity Protection(SIP)可能会阻止Hadoop访问某些系统目录。如果你在开启SIP的情况下遇到问题,可以尝试暂时禁用SIP,但请注意这会降低系统的安全性。 5. **重新启动Hadoop**:完成上述步骤后,重启Hadoop服务以应用更改。你可以在Hadoop的sbin目录下使用`start-dfs.sh`和`start-yarn.sh`命令启动Hadoop。 6. **检查日志**:如果问题仍然存在,查看Hadoop的日志文件(如`$HADOOP_HOME/logs/*`)可以帮助你找出更具体的问题所在。 7. **社区资源**:如果以上步骤不能解决问题,可以查阅Apache Hadoop的官方文档,或者在相关的开发者论坛和社区(如Stack Overflow)寻求帮助。提供具体的错误信息和你已经尝试过的解决方案会有助于其他人更好地帮助你。 记住,处理这种问题通常需要耐心和细致,因为涉及到的操作系统、Java环境、编译和配置等多个环节都可能导致问题出现。通过逐步排查和适当地查阅资料,你应该能够解决“Unable to load
native
-hadoop library”的问题。
2024-08-26 15:01:07
42.97MB
hadoop
macos
native
1
jdk-11.0.14_windows-x64_bin
Java开发工具包(Java Development Kit,简称JDK)是用于编写和运行Java应用程序的重要软件包。JDK 11.0.14是Oracle公司发布的一个稳定版本,针对Windows 64位操作系统。这个版本包含了Java编译器、Java运行环境、Java类库以及开发者工具,如Java调试器和性能分析工具等,是Java开发者必不可少的基础工具。 在Java编程中,React
Native
与Java的结合使用主要体现在Android应用开发上。React
Native
是由Facebook开发的一款开源框架,它允许开发者使用JavaScript和React来构建原生移动应用。然而,由于Android应用的核心是用Java或Kotlin编写的,因此在React
Native
的Android项目中,我们仍然需要接触和理解Java语言,以便与React
Native
的JavaScript层进行交互。 在JDK 11中,有几个重要的更新和改进: 1. **模块系统(Project Jigsaw)**:Java 9引入了模块系统,而JDK 11对这一特性进行了进一步优化,使得大型项目更容易管理和维护。模块化有助于减少类路径问题,提高应用的启动速度和安全性。 2. **HTTP客户端API**:JDK 11提供了内置的HTTP客户端API(java.net.http.HttpClient),这是一个非阻塞的API,能够更高效地处理网络请求。 3. **文本块(Text Blocks)**:这是一个新的语法特性,用于方便地编写多行字符串,避免了转义字符的困扰,提高了代码的可读性。 4. **改进的垃圾收集器**:JDK 11引入了ZGC(Z Garbage Collector),这是一种低延迟的垃圾收集器,适用于大内存应用。 5. **动态CDS(Class-Data Sharing)**:这个功能允许在JVM启动时共享已加载的类数据,从而提高应用启动速度。 6. **增强的switch表达式**:Java 11的switch语句可以作为表达式使用,支持模式匹配,增加了编程的灵活性。 7. **局部变量类型推断(Project Coin)**:通过var关键字,开发者可以省略局部变量的类型声明,由编译器自动推断。 8. **JEP 330:提前初始化**:这是一项优化,确保模块在启动时就被正确初始化,提升了应用的稳定性。 9. **JEP 325:删除Java EE和 CORBA模块**:这些模块不再包含在标准版JDK中,以减小JDK的体积和维护成本。 了解和掌握这些JDK 11的关键特性对于Java开发者来说至关重要,特别是在结合React
Native
进行Android应用开发时,能够提升开发效率和应用性能。在安装和使用JDK 11.0.14_windows-x64_bin.exe时,确保操作系统兼容,并遵循官方的安装指南,以确保顺利进行开发工作。同时,保持对JDK的更新,以便利用最新的性能改进和安全修复。
2024-08-02 20:27:00
138.76MB
react
native
java
1
c# framework 微信
native
支付V3
c# framework 微信
native
支付V3
2024-05-08 21:53:36
12.26MB
微信
native
1
react-
native
-document-scanner:文档扫描仪,具有实时边框检测,透视校正,图像过滤器等功能! :mobile_phone_with_arrow::camera_with_flash:
React
Native
Document Scanner 实时文档检测库。 返回捕获图像的URI或base64编码的字符串,使您可以轻松地存储它或随意使用它! 特征 : 实时检测 透视校正和图像裁剪 实时相机滤镜(亮度,饱和度,对比度) 闪 易于使用的base64图像 可以很容易地用插入 两个平台 如果您使用的是本机0.48+,请使用版本> = 1.4.1 $ yarn add https://github.com/Michaelvilleneuve/react-
native
-document-scanner $ react-
native
link react-
native
-do
2024-04-13 14:30:06
83.09MB
ios
react-native
scanner
document
1
Science research writing for non-
native
and
native
speakers
科学论文写作包括第一版和第二版,帮助快速入门英语论文写作 Science research writing for non-
native
and
native
speakers
2024-04-11 09:04:49
118.42MB
英语论文写作
1
react-
native
-tts:React适用于Android和iOS的
Native
Text-To-Speech库
React本地TTS React
Native
TTS是用于iOS,Android和Windows上的的文本到语音库。 文献资料 安装 npm install --save react-
native
-tts react-
native
link react-
native
-tts 用法 进口货 import Tts from 'react-
native
-tts' ; 视窗 在windows/myapp.sln将RNTTS项目添加到您的解决方案中: 在Visual Studio 2019中打开解决方案 右键单击解决方案资源管理器中的“解决方案”图标>添加>现有项目 选择node_modules\react-
native
-tts\windows\RNTTS\RNTTS.vcxproj 在windows/myapp/myapp.vcxproj添加引用RNTTS到您的主应用程序项目。 从Visu
2024-04-01 09:47:06
352KB
Java
1
C# 微信支付ApiV3源码
.Net版本的微信支付V3版,分别集成JSAPI支付/小程序支付、APP支付、h5支付、
Native
支付、查询订单、关闭订单、订单退款、支付通知等。 文件拷贝到.net项目中,调用具体方法时传入对应的参数即可使用,文件所需要的DLL通过NuGet程序包进行安装,具体可查看方法注释。 本源码结合微信支付官方文档,网上各方面的相关资料进行测试、整理。 1、JSAPI支付/小程序支付、APP支付方法返回调起支付的参数 2、h5支付方法返回h5支付地址 3、
Native
支付方法方法返回传入的二维码的地址 4、查询订单、关闭订单、订单退款、支付通知等方法返回官方文档说明的参数,可根据实际需求对参数进行解析
2024-03-08 13:56:27
12KB
微信支付
JSAPI支付
Native支付
微信支付回调
1
Android NDK实现Binder服务和客户端
需要在系统源码下编译,或者提取出对应的头文件亦可。这里需要注意Android4.x以后系统SeLinux如果打开,系统级需要配置对应的sepolicy才能使用。测试阶段推荐直接setenforce 0关闭鉴权即可
2024-02-28 21:41:15
388KB
Android
Native
Binder
Source
1
social-media-smartphone-app:用React
Native
编写的社交媒体应用
社交媒体智能手机应用 用React
Native
编写的社交媒体应用程序。 应用需要连接到使用postgresql创建的数据库。 该应用程序的主要目标是将参与附近同一事件的用户配对(“ tinderlike”用户向右滑动以喜欢一个人,然后向左滑动以拒绝)。 一旦允许配对的用户互相发短信,创建新事件并在他们的墙上添加帖子。 用户还可以个性化他们的个人资料:更改个人资料照片,个人信息,描述等。
2024-02-18 10:38:51
135.76MB
TypeScript
1
fullstack-react-
native
-book-r2
import React from 'react'; import { StyleSheet, Text, View } from 'react-
native
'; export default class StyledText extends React.Component { render() { return (
2024-02-04 20:35:44
41.32MB
reactive
native
1
个人信息
点我去登录
购买积分
下载历史
恢复订单
热门下载
模型预测控制MPC(模型预测电流控制,MPCC)的simulink仿真,2016b版本
EasyMedia-ui.zip
西安问题电缆-工程伦理案例分析.zip
quartus II13.0器件库.zip
计算机专业实习日记+实习周记+实习总结
中小型企业网络建设.pkt
数字图像处理[冈萨雷斯]
python实现的学生信息管理系统—GUI界面版
Python+OpenCV实现行人检测(含配置说明)
全国河流水文站坐标.xls
基于Python网络爬虫毕业论文.doc
基于Matlab的PI/4 DQPSK的调制解调源代吗
东南大学英语技术写作慕课所有答案
2020年数学建模B题(国二)论文.pdf
机械臂碰撞检测 八组逆解碰撞检测 机械臂避障路径规划
最新下载
Plex v7.12电视端app
IBM CPLEX 12.10 学术版 mac操作系统安装包
ADC参数测试资料&matlab源程序
城市规划GIS技术应用指南_随书练习数据
支付宝低保真原型作业.rp
数理统计(第二版)赵选民,徐伟等
python爬虫数据可视化分析大作业带文档
支付宝App低保真原型设计(课后答案).rp
《AxureRP9网站与App原型设计》教学教案-10支付宝App低保真原型设计.docx
支付宝原型设计低保真-Axure9.zip
其他资源
系统分析师-带目录
磁偶极子天线仿真与制作
实用化工计算机模拟-Matlab在化学工程中的应用.pdf
基于搜狗微信搜索的微信公众号爬虫接口demo
智能电饭煲
matlab 整流器仿真
中文词语数据库文件
ILI9341 STM32驱动显示程序
网上书店 Java web 源码及报告
东南大学 随机过程 陈明 答案
【软件测试】报告(精)和作业
WA161DD-NZ最新版本
moveit-next:应用程序可构建NLW04 da ROCKETSEAT-源码
day6视频.rar
常用阻值表.docx
makefile学习用测试文件.rar
Delphi5应用程序设计实例.doc
mysql-connector-java-8.0.19.jar
AES算法源码~~~~~~~~~~~~
Cannon乘法的MPI实现
java 基于p2p文件传输
模糊聚类分析图的k截距程序
access2007宝典+光盘资料.
OpenStack Mitaka for Ubuntu 16.04 LTS 部署指南